Struct DefineField 

Source
pub struct DefineField {
    pub path: Spanned<Idiom>,
    pub table: Spanned<String>,
    pub ty: Option<Spanned<TypeExpr>>,
    pub overwrite: bool,
    pub default: Option<Spanned<Expr>>,
    pub value: Option<Spanned<Expr>>,
    pub computed: Option<Spanned<Expr>>,
    pub reference: bool,
    pub assert: Option<Spanned<Expr>>,
    pub readonly: bool,
    pub permissions: Vec<Spanned<Expr>>,
}
Expand description

DEFINE FIELD — a (possibly nested) field on a table, with its declared type.

Fields§

§path: Spanned<Idiom>

The (possibly nested) field path.

§table: Spanned<String>

The table the field belongs to.

§ty: Option<Spanned<TypeExpr>>

TYPE <type> — the declared field type, if any.

§overwrite: bool

OVERWRITE — redefine an existing field.

§default: Option<Spanned<Expr>>

DEFAULT <expr> — supplied when a row is created without the field.

§value: Option<Spanned<Expr>>

VALUE <expr> — the field is computed; writes are overwritten.

§computed: Option<Spanned<Expr>>

COMPUTED <expr> — the field is derived from an expression and never stored (SurrealDB 3.0). Like VALUE, its type is the expression’s; a common form is a record-reference back-traversal (COMPUTED <~team).

§reference: bool

REFERENCE — the field’s record<...> link participates in reference traversal (<~), so a back-reference on the target table can resolve through it.

§assert: Option<Spanned<Expr>>

ASSERT <expr> — must hold for every write ($value in scope).

§readonly: bool

READONLY — writable only at creation.

§permissions: Vec<Spanned<Expr>>

PERMISSIONS FOR <action> WHERE <expr> predicate expressions. Each WHERE predicate is retained so the analyzer can walk it against the row; NONE/FULL carry no predicate.
